You may think this is a dumb question but what does pro cure do for the prawn tails , does it firm them up , add flavor , add color . Can you just use the prawn tails as is and will they work ?
Title: Re: Pro Cure ???
Post by: Fish Assassin on June 28, 2005, 08:27:44 PM
It toughens them and add colour. Yes, you can use them fresh.
